The Netonix WS-6-MINI WISP Switch is a compact, high-voltage switch designed specifically for wireless ISP networks. It supports 48V passive PoE powering and offers flexible power input options including 48-53V DC POE adapters or barrel connectors up to 2A. While the power adapter is not included, it can be powered directly from another WISP switch or compatible power sources, making it an efficient and space-saving solution for professional network deployments.

Robust switch
These Netonix ws6 mini switches are great. This one is powered by POE and using the same cable for uplink. I have 3 cameras, one AP, and a work station powered from this switch using POE (except the work station). The switch has been happily doing this for the last 18 months while sitting in a cantex box outside my house. It stays dry, but is exposed to humidity and high temperature constantly. This is a reliable capable switch and if you have a use case for it you won't be disappointed.

Put power distribution and network switching on the tower!
This is a really nice and easy to understand managed switch with a whole lot of capability in a small package. It's also powered by POE and can supply POE to your radios / routers / etc.I'm using this to avoid running several ethernet cables up a tall tower - just one run of ToughCable supplies power to the netonix and the netonix powers 3 radios 100' in the air. So far it seems like it's going to be the perfect solution for this application.
